Gilbert Andrews Obituary

Gilbert H. Andrews
Gilbert H. Andrews, 84, of East Hartford, loving husband of 49 years to Mary (Gilmister) Andrews, passed away peacefully on Friday, January 23, 2026. He was born on October 22, 1941, in Hartford, son to the late Willard and Adelaide (McKinney) Andrews.
Gil grew up in Glastonbury and graduated from Glastonbury High School. He enjoyed a long and successful career in industrial manufacturing. A lifelong sports enthusiast, Gil actively participated in softball, horseshoes, golf, and bowling, continuing to bowl regularly until August of last year. He was also a devoted sports fan who especially loved cheering on his children and grandson at their own athletic events, taking great pride in watching them play. Gil treasured time spent playing games with his family and was always willing to help with any project that needed doing. A firm believer that anything could be fixed with enough effort, and that no piece of scrap wood should ever be discarded, he was known for his determination, generosity, and practical wisdom. Gil was kind, caring, deeply devoted to his family, and will be dearly missed by all who knew and loved him.
In addition to his wife, Gil is survived by his children, Paul Andrews and his wife Jolene of Marlborough, Karolyn Andrews of Manchester, and Bill Andrews of Goshen; his two grandchildren, Colin Reilly and Alicia Andrews; his sister, Louise Macca of East Hartford; his brothers, Gary Andrews of Norwalk and David Andrews and his wife Brenda of Hebron; as well as his nephews and the Paulus Family. Gil was predeceased by his parents; his son, Gil Andrews; as well as his in-laws, Sebastian Macca and Leslie Andrews.
A Mass of Christian Burial will be celebrated on Saturday, February 7, 2026, beginning at 10 a.m. at the North American Martyrs Parish- St. Mary's Church, 15 Maplewood Ave., East Hartford. Guests are kindly asked to please go directly to the church. Burial will follow in Green Cemetery, Glastonbury.
